Print Quality Defect - Poor Fuse Grade Issues in Ambient Temperatures

Issue description

This document deals with a "poor fuse grade" print quality defect when the printer is within an ambient environment.

Recommendation

StepAction
1Power the printer Off for a few minutes, and then perform a test print.
2

If the print quality defect persists, tap Settings on the control panel, then go to Paper > Tray Configuration.

3 Select the appropriate paper type currently loaded on the tray and tap Save.
4

Should the issue persist, tap Settings > Paper > Media Configuration > Media Types.

5

Adjust the media texture setting to Rough and the media weight setting to Heavy. This will also slightly increase the fusing temperature.

E.g., Plain- Texture (Rough) and Weight (Heavy)

6Click Submit and perform a test print.
